What if the person with everything decided the system was broken—and then put her money where her mouth is? That’s not a headline. That’s Marlene Engelhorn’s real life. In this episode of Reppin, Marlene—yes, a multi-millionaire heiress from Vienna—breaks down why growing up rich wasn’t the dream everyone assumes… and how waking up to her privilege pushed her to become one of the most outspoken voices for wealth redistribution, tax reform, and economic justice. This isn’t performative philanthropy. It’s not guilt. It’s ACTION. REAL action. She literally gave away her inheritance. She co-founded Tax Me Now. She’s building a citizens' assembly to decide how to redistribute her wealth—democratically.
